Is it possible to enable eclipse/wtp to also scan javascript files so that
it picks up TODO task tags?

I looked up in the preferences, and I saw that you could specify a bunch
of file types (CSS DTD XML JSP HTML), but no javascript. Is there a way
to add more?

WTP 3.0 has this feature, just type "task tags" into the preferences
dialog search box.
